Anthony Jelonch back from injury and captain of the French XV: “I’m 100%”

Ligaments ruptured on February 26, operated on March 6, captain of the French XV in the World Cup on September 14. Anthony Jelonch is already making his comeback on the field this Thursday, against Uruguay. The third row gave his impressions at a press conference this Tuesday.

You return after your injury as captain. What do you feel and have you doubted?

ANTHONY JELONCH. I am very happy to come back. I had doubts at the start of my rehabilitation, but I knew that I had 6 months, I really had this World Cup in mind, I worked very hard to give myself the chance to participate. Being captain is a huge source of pride for me, I will do everything to lead this team to victory.

How have these six months been since your operation?

I had surgery on March 6, a little over six months ago. I had doubts, but at each step, I moved forward. I spent 5 weeks with Bruno Boussagol, the physiotherapist of the French team, in Montpellier, then 4 weeks at the Stade Toulouse, then at the CERS in Capbreton. I wasn’t in a routine, that helped me. I will give everything now. My knee is holding up well, I have the green light from all the physiotherapists, doctors, surgeons who have been following me since the beginning. In my head I am 100%.

How do you explain this mental strength to come back?

I come from a world where the mind takes up a lot of space, from a very young age. I’m from the countryside, that helps too. This goal, the World Cup, helped me come back quickly and strong. This injury ultimately made me grow.

Have you discussed the role of captain with your friend Antoine Dupont?

Players like him are there to help me for these three days until the match, even if they are not on the scoresheet, they have a say. This is what makes this group strong. Even me, in recovery, if I wanted to say something, I could. There are several leaders, Antoine, Charles (Ollivon), Gaël (Fickou)… the strong guys in this team, they talk all the time and lead this group.

You were captain on tour in Australia in 2021, what memories do you have of it?

I had this experience on this tour in Australia, it went pretty well for the team, we won one test out of the three and narrowly lost the other two, while we were promised hell. It made us grow and me as a leader. I remember the positive.

How did you feel when you learned that you could play in this World Cup?

I’ve been preparing for this for a few weeks, I was training hard all last week. Fabien (Galthié) told me: you choose the match you are going to play. I told him: as quickly as possible. He told me that I was captain this weekend, I was very happy. I thought about all the hard times since this injury. I’m not a very emotional person, but it’s a lot of fun. I can’t wait to be on the pitch on Thursday. It’s the first time I’ve come to Lille to play rugby, it’s more of a football region. We’re going to give them the best show possible.
